The Reason for the Season: SUNDAY, December 5, 2010



The holidays will soon be here.
The time we’re ‘sposed to brim with cheer.

Twinkling lights and stunning tree
Cards and gifts for all to see.

Sweets and drinks and chips with dips
Scrooge, please spare expanding hips.

 

Amidst the flurry of the season
We must contemplate the reason.

A baby in a bed of hay
Changed the world from where he lay.

Sweet Baby Jesus is the reason
For this most sweet, amazing season

Hope yours is blessed to the very brim
But please remember to think of Him.
